Reasons to consider Radeon HD 6970

Based on an outdated architecture (ATI TeraScale), there are no performance optimizations for current games and applications

Reasons to consider Radeon R7 260X

135 watts lower power draw. This might be a strong point if your current power supply is not enough to handle the Radeon HD 6970 .
This is a much newer product, it might have better long term support.
Supports Direct3D 12 Async Compute
Supports FreeSync
Supports ReLive (allows game streaming/recording with minimum performance penalty)
Supports TrueAudio
Based on an outdated architecture (AMD GCN), there may be no performance optimizations for current games and applications

No clear winner declared

These graphics cards seems to have comparable performance based on the game benchmark suite used (6 combinations of games and resolutions).


Specifications

Core Configuration

Radeon HD 6970Radeon R7 260X
GPU NameCayman (Cayman XT)vsBonaire (Bonaire XTX)
Fab Process40 nmvs28 nm
Die Size389 mm²vs160 mm²
Transistors2,640 millionvs2,080 million
Shaders1536vs896
Compute Units24vs14
Core clock880 MHzvs1100 MHz
ROPs32vs16
TMUs96vs56

Memory Configuration

Radeon HD 6970Radeon R7 260X
Memory TypeGDDR5vsGDDR5
Bus Width256 bitvs128 bit
Memory Speed1375 MHz
5500 MHz effective
vs1625 MHz
6500 MHz effective
Memory Size2048 Mbvs2048 Mb

Additional details

Radeon HD 6970Radeon R7 260X
TDP250 wattsvs115 watts
Release Date14 Dec 2010vs8 Oct 2013
